Job Overview

As a Senior Technical Project Manager at TEKsystems, you will lead large-scale infrastructure projects, coordinating resources and ensuring timely delivery within budget and scope.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age project plans, coordinating resources and ensuring timely delivery
  • Establish scope control procedures and develop documentation
  • Monitor and report project status, assessing the effectiveness of documentation
  • Initiate and maintain reporting relationships with stakeholders, including team members, peers, managers, customers, vendors, and other affected departments
  • Analyze and report project status, researching information and monitoring project performance
  • Effectively assist in directing internal and external resources to achieve business solutions within project guidelines
  • Respond to operational issues and RFI's within defined areas of responsibility
  • Collaborate and communicate with other project managers and leaders to coordinate cross-project initiatives and activities
  • Identify and eliminate obstacles to solution plans, business goals, or implementation
  • Assist in the development and implementation of contingency plans
  • Organize the management agenda, coordinating materials and communications for meetings and off-sites
  • Coordinate routines to understand trends in Workforce Management, with a focus on developing reporting related to current and future trends
  • Support strategic planning involved with Location Management, privacy wall, and move coordination
  • Participate in driving communication plans for key initiatives and events
  • Develop and maintain management calendars for deliverables and governance routines
  • Define and produce key metrics
  • Familiarity with BAC processes & tools (Nexus, ITSM, etc.)

Requirements:

  • 3-5 years of PM or blended PM/BA experience
  • Soft skills are important for this team, including being eager and wanting to be there
